Like I said, I read a lot of great books the last two months. The only books I felt mediocre about were ones that I had to read for class. I read a total of eight books in November, and eight in December. Six of those were for school, so ten of them were for fun. Some of my favorites and almost favorites of the year came from the last two months, like Emma and The Lady’s Guide to Celestial Mechanics. I also read some great YA books just in the past week that I loved, including Layoverland and Cemetery Boys. Keep reading under the cut for the full list of books I read the last two months!
November Books
- Malibu Rising by Taylor Jenkins Reid – 4/5 stars
- Zami: A New Spelling of my Name by Audre Lorde – 3.5/5 stars
- The Blacker the Berry by Wallace Thurman – 4/5 stars
- The Joy Luck Club by Amy Tan – 4/5 stars
- Funny Boy by Shyam Selvadurai – 5/5 stars
- Quicksand by Nella Larsen – 4/5 stars
- The Lady’s Guide to Celestial Mechanics by Olivia Waite – 4.5/5 stars
- Passing by Nella Larsen – 4/5 stars
December Books
- Stone Butch Blues by Leslie Feinberg – 5/5 stars
- Their Eyes Were Watching God by Zora Neal Hurston – 3.5/5 stars
- Portrait of a Thief by Grace D. Li – 4/5 stars
- Emma by Jane Austen – 5/5 stars
- Layoverland by Gabby Noone – 4/5 stars
- Untamed by Glennon Doyle – 4/5 stars
- Cemetery Boys by Aiden Thomas – 4.5/5 stars
- I Wish You All the Best by Mason Deaver – 4/5 stars
